Biddulph Mansions
Biddulph Mansions is a residential building in Westminster, Greater London, England which is located on Elgin Avenue. Biddulph Mansions is situated nearby to Bowls and Tennis Pavilion, as well as near the metro station Maida Vale tube station.- Type: Residential building
- Address: Elgin Avenue, London, W9 1HY
- Roof shape: flat

Maida Vale is a London Underground station in Maida Vale, north-west London. It is on the Bakerloo line, between Kilburn Park and Warwick Avenue stations. Maida Vale tube station is situated 640 feet northeast of Biddulph Mansions.

The Lauderdale Road Spanish & Portuguese Synagogue, more commonly called the Lauderdale Road Synagogue, is an Orthodox Jewish congregation and synagogue, located in Maida Vale on Lauderdale Road in the City of Westminster, West London, England, in the United Kingdom. Lauderdale Road synagogue is situated 780 feet southeast of Biddulph Mansions.

London Paddington is a main line and tube station complex on Praed Street, Paddington, London, which has been the main terminus for the Great Western Railway and successors since 1838. London Paddington railway station is situated 1 mile southeast of Biddulph Mansions.

Little Venice is an affluent residential district in North West London, England, around the junction of the Paddington Arm of the Grand Union Canal, the Regent's Canal, and the entrance to Paddington Basin.

St John's Wood is a district in the City of Westminster, London, England, about 2.5 miles northwest of Charing Cross. Historically the northern part of the ancient parish and Metropolitan Borough of Marylebone, it extends from Regent's Park and Primrose Hill in the east to Edgware Road in the west, with the Swiss Cottage area of Hampstead to the north and Lisson Grove to the south.
